Wal Mart stops selling e-cigarettes. Should American e-cigarettes be cool?

On September 20 local time, Wal Mart, an American supermarket chain, announced that it would stop selling e-cigarettes, which applies to all Wal Mart stores in the United States.

Wal Mart said the decision stems from the recent ban on the e-cigarette industry by the White House Government and several state governments. The White House announced on September 11 local time that it would issue a ban on the sale of flavored e-cigarettes.

According to the data of the U.S. public health department, the number of deaths related to e-cigarettes in the United States has risen to 6, and there are more than 450 cases of serious lung disease caused by suspected e-cigarettes.
